Data bootstrapping and facing my mortality 137 implied HN points • 21 Jun 22 Use bootstrap to estimate performance in a larger setting without testing on a bigger dataset. Randomly sample from a small dataset multiple times to understand potential outcomes. Bootstrapping can be useful in predicting outcomes with limited data, like product performance in a larger group.

Sam helps me to low-key understand radio waves through his master thesis 58 implied HN points • 22 Nov 22 Radio waves are generated by applying current to an antenna and are part of the electromagnetic spectrum. RF technology is not just for choppy car radio music, but also for medical treatments and object detection. Energy can be transmitted wirelessly using radio waves, and antennas play a crucial role in transmitting and receiving them.

MSP430 I2C, and Trusting ChatGPT Wasted Weeks of My Life 19 implied HN points • 28 Jun 23 🕹 Technology Microcontrollers Debugging Hardware communication involves protocols like I2C, UART, and SPI for connecting microcontrollers with peripherals. In I2C communication, there are master and slave devices, and the correct implementation details are crucial for success. Consulting the manufacturer's datasheet is essential for troubleshooting hardware issues, despite guidance from tools like ChatGPT.
